Invest in stocks

Once you buy stock, you become a partner in a limited company, and all shareholders own the company together. The shares are regularly used as a source of capital for companies looking to sell their stock and attract new investors.

The corporation makes money only when the shares are sold for the first time on the stock exchange. Invest in Mutual Funds

Any fund is a collection of many securities, most commonly shares. When you put money into a mutual fund, you get fund units, a portion of the company’s total assets, but you don’t get individual shares or become partners in the firms the fund invests in.

When a fund invests in a company’s stock, you become an indirect owner, but instead of buying the store directly, you delegate that responsibility to the fund manager. Of course, the ultimate goal is for the money to grow over time. You can find more information on funds here.

Invest in exchange-traded funds (ETFs)

Any exchange-traded fund (or ETF in English) varies from traditional funds in that it is listed on a stock exchange and can be exchanged many times on the same day.

Compared to actively managed equity funds, the management charge is frequently lower. On the other hand, investing often entails a brokerage fee, similar to shares, which is rarely the case when purchasing classic funds.

Invest in Bonds

Bonds are a type of loan that states or businesses sell to investors rather than taking out a bank loan. When you acquire a bond, you effectively become a lender to the bond’s issuer. The state or firm pays you interest as a lender during the bond term.

Bonds have the distinct advantage that when the loan matures, the investor often receives 100% of the original investment, making them safe and dependable investments.

Diversification throughout time, such as in monthly savings, is an often-overlooked dimension to consider. Regular purchases have various advantages because you can buy in both ups and downs, resulting in equal portfolio development.

In other words, regular purchases at the bottom counteract the harmful effect of purchasing at the top. You escape the headache of trying to time the market, which is extremely difficult to achieve. A more uniform development and purchase price imply you’re less likely to lose a significant portion of your capital on the day you want to remove it.
